Output 75dfdac574d46c419a520069c4a2da082c4827b854cf000c4b02fe9e4fdaf0e6:0

value
29081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89931b6d9f8cdcc5ee3334f8296bccc12cac9a6 OP_EQUAL
address
3MSHQ6faHJcE8asAvXeFSVyzWgUDejoogd
transaction
75dfdac574d46c419a520069c4a2da082c4827b854cf000c4b02fe9e4fdaf0e6
spent
true